There are currently around 2250 family memberships.
On a good day as many as 500 people or more will visit the range.
Since it is unsupervised a lot of misuse and abuse has occurred to the point of overwhelming the maintenance dept.
and costing a lot in repairs and replacement.
The board of directors voted to cutoff membership at that level for a while.
After about Feb they will look at the renewal rate and make a decision
on opening up membership.
Outdoor range membership at that time will be offered to current indoor range members first.
If any openings are left they will be offered to the current waiting list.
(This from questions at last months general member meeting)
For anyone interested it sounded like you should join the indoor range to bypass the waiting list which i think they said was at 300
